Rock band teams up with Activision to create dedicated version of Guitar Hero.

Guitar Hero was the best selling video game of 2007, and now it’s branching out with a new version – and it will be the first music-based game to feature one band.

Guitar Hero: Aerosmith will allows gamers to experience the band’s Grammy winning career, from the first gig to becoming rock royalty. As fans progress, they can rock out to Aerosmith’s greatest hits, as well as songs from artists that the band has either performed with or been inspired by in some way.

“We are extremely excited that Aerosmith chose to team up with Guitar Hero, bringing one of the world’s all-time best selling artists together with one of the biggest video game brands, to deliver a new and unique interactive way for our customers to connect with the artists and their music,” explained Dusty Welch, head of publishing for Activision/Red Octane.

“This partnership will give Aerosmith, a band that has sold more than 150 million albums worldwide, a powerful and innovative platform to reach their fans and new audiences.”

The game is due to roll out in June on Microsoft's Xbox 360, Sony's PlayStation 2 and PlayStation, plus Nintendo Wii.
